Rob Farley(Posted 2006) [#6]
Steve... You're right... I must do some more texture work at some point!

The only reason I'm showing this is because it was actually a very complex bit of code to get the guys to run to pick a side of the helicopter, get to the bases of the ramp, run up them, get inside, and then stand in a specifc place based on how many people are already in the helicopter... Oh and not to try to get in if there are already 6 people in there. And once they're in they parent themselves to the helicopter too...

And I haven't done them getting out yet!
